C++ inherits a host of opportunities for type violations from C and adds a few of its own.
– Bjarne Stroustrup, "A rationale for semantically enhanced library languages"
02. Declarations and Initialization (DCL)
05. Floating Point Arithmetic (FLP)
06. Arrays and STL Containers (ARR)
07. Characters and Strings (STR)
VOID 14. Templates and the STL (STL)